Context

Let me explain what this system error actually represents.

The analysis framework in question operates on a two-phase model. Phase one extracts raw information points from source material. Phase two performs deep analysis across nine dimensions: technical architecture, token economics, market positioning, ecosystem niche, regulatory compliance, team and governance, risk matrix, narrative cycles, and industry chain transmission effects.

The constraint is explicit: "Every dimension of analysis must be based on phase one information points. Avoid baseless speculation."

When phase one returns zero information points, the system faces a choice. It can fabricate plausible-sounding analysis from nothing, generating content that looks authoritative but has no evidential foundation. Or it can refuse.

It chose refusal.

This is remarkable because the entire incentive structure of the blockchain intelligence economy rewards the opposite behavior. Analysts are paid for output volume. Research firms are valued for publication frequency. Twitter threads reward confidence, not epistemic humility. The market has created a system where producing analysis from nothing is not just common practice—it is the dominant business model.

Consider what the framework identified as its own failure conditions:

First, "all conclusions will be water without a source." This is precisely what happens when you read most crypto analysis. Conclusions float free of any anchoring evidence. Price predictions are issued without models. Security assessments are delivered without code review. Tokenomics evaluations are published without reading the token contract.

Second, "all inferences will become baseless speculation." The framework explicitly distinguishes between three epistemic categories: what the original text explicitly states, what can be reasonably inferred, and what is highly speculative. In zero-data conditions, everything falls into the third category. The framework refuses to pretend otherwise.

Third, "the analysis results will have no reference value and may even mislead." This is the sentence that should be printed on every crypto research report ever published. The industry is drowning in analysis that actively misleads because it was generated without adequate input data.

The framework then offers three remediation paths. Provide the complete first-phase output. Provide the original text directly. Or provide minimum viable information for a simplified analysis covering only data-supported dimensions.

Notice what the framework does not offer. It does not offer to guess.

Core

Let me take this system error seriously as a design pattern for the blockchain intelligence layer.

The nine-dimension analysis framework itself is worth examining. This is not your standard crypto research template. It is a structured evaluation system that treats blockchain projects as complex systems requiring multi-axial assessment. Let me analyze each dimension as a smart contract architect would evaluate a protocol's security model.

Dimension one: Technical analysis. The framework asks for technical positioning, advancement assessment, and feasibility judgment. In my experience auditing smart contracts, this is where most market analysis fails catastrophically. Analysts evaluate whether a project is "good" based on team pedigree or narrative momentum. They do not evaluate whether the cryptographic primitives are sound, whether the state management can scale, whether the upgrade mechanism introduces centralization vectors. The framework's demand for technical feasibility assessment is institutional-grade. Most retail investors have never seen a proper technical due diligence document. The gap between what the framework demands and what the market provides is the gap between institutional security standards and hope.

Dimension two: Token economics. Supply structure, incentive sustainability, value capture mechanisms. I have written extensively about how most token models are designed backwards. The team decides on a valuation, works backward to a supply schedule, and then retrofits a value capture narrative. The framework's demand for incentive sustainability analysis would catch most of these failures. But it requires data. Real data. Emission schedules. Vesting curves. Actual usage metrics. Not projections. Not "potential." Actual on-chain data.

Dimension three: Market analysis. Price impact, sentiment judgment, competitive landscape. This dimension is the most data-hungry and the most prone to garbage-in-garbage-out failure. Market analysis without market data is astrology. The framework's refusal to produce it from nothing is an implicit acknowledgment that market analysis has an evidence threshold.

Dimension four: Ecosystem niche analysis. Industry chain positioning, dependency relationships, developer and user signals. This is where I see the most sophisticated failures. Projects do not exist in isolation. They sit in dependency graphs. A DeFi protocol depends on its oracle, its lending market, its liquidation engine, its bridge to other chains. The framework's demand for ecosystem analysis recognizes that individual project assessment is incomplete without understanding the surrounding infrastructure.

Dimension five: Regulatory compliance analysis. Security attribute assessment, compliance status, regulatory risk. This dimension is increasingly existential. The framework's inclusion of regulatory analysis as a core dimension, not a footnote, reflects the post-ETF institutional reality. Regulatory risk is not a tail risk. It is a primary risk.

Dimension six: Team and governance analysis. Team background, governance health, investor quality. This is the dimension where data scarcity is most acute and where fabrication is most dangerous. Team analysis requires verification. Actual verification. Not LinkedIn profiles. Not Twitter followers. Verification of claims, track records, and actual contribution history.

Dimension seven: Risk matrix analysis. Six-dimensional risk: technical, market, operational, regulatory, competitive, narrative. This is the pre-mortem dimension. The framework's demand for a structured risk matrix across six axes is exactly what I have advocated for years. Most market participants think about risk as price volatility. The framework understands that price volatility is the output, not the risk. The risks are technical failures, market structure failures, operational failures, regulatory actions, competitive displacement, and narrative collapse.

Dimension eight: Narrative and expectation analysis. Narrative heat cycles, expectation gaps, sentiment indicators. This is the dimension most analysts get completely wrong because they mistake their own sentiment for market sentiment. The framework's demand for expectation gap analysis—the difference between what the market expects and what is actually likely—is sophisticated. Narrative analysis without data becomes narrative participation. The analyst becomes part of the story they are supposed to be analyzing.

Dimension nine: Industry chain transmission analysis. Upstream and downstream impacts, segment-level shock assessment. This is the macro dimension. How does a protocol failure transmit through the ecosystem? How does a regulatory action in one jurisdiction affect infrastructure in another? This dimension requires mapping the dependency graph and stress-testing propagation paths.

Every one of these dimensions requires input data. Real data. Verified data. The framework understands that analysis without data is not analysis. It is fiction.

Now let me stress-test the framework itself. What are its failure modes?

First, the framework's nine dimensions are comprehensive but not exhaustive. Missing dimensions include: security audit history and quality, bug bounty program status, insurance coverage, and operational redundancy. A project could pass all nine dimensions and still be catastrophically insecure.

Second, the framework's information point extraction depends on the quality of the source material. Garbage source material produces garbage information points. The framework validates completeness, not accuracy. An analyst could provide a complete extraction of a fundamentally flawed source document.

Third, the framework's simplified analysis mode (Option C) creates a potential degradation pathway. If the market learns that minimum viable information produces acceptable output, the incentive to provide complete data weakens. The framework's standards could drift downward through market pressure.

Fourth, the framework's refusal behavior is binary. It does not offer probabilistic analysis with confidence intervals. It offers a binary: sufficient data or insufficient data. This is overly rigid. Some analysis with partial data and explicit confidence markers is better than no analysis.

But these are minor design criticisms. The core principle is sound: analysis without data is fabrication. The framework understands this. The market does not.
